Output 34d56f1016964338882a874308693dfe86523aad75b87cb3c7633b782237cf7f:1

value
15022703
script pubkey
OP_0 OP_PUSHBYTES_20 8dc2860fd7555f761b2640369541a87cd854ebc5
address
ltc1q3hpgvr7h240hvxexgqmf2sdg0nv9f67966ufz9
transaction
34d56f1016964338882a874308693dfe86523aad75b87cb3c7633b782237cf7f
spent
true